Associations between Abortion, Mental Disorders, and Suicidal Behaviour in a Nationally Representative Sample
Bibliographic record
Abstract
OBJECTIVE: Most previous studies that have investigated the relation between abortion and mental illness have presented mixed findings. We examined the relation between abortion, mental disorders, and suicidality using a US nationally representative sample. METHODS: Data came from the National Comorbidity Survey Replication (n = 3310 women, aged 18 years and older). The World Health Organization-Composite International Diagnostic Interview was used to assess mental disorders based on the Diagnostic and Statistical Manual of Mental Disorders, Fourth Edition, criteria and lifetime abortion in women. Multiple logistic regression analyses were employed to examine associations between abortion and lifetime mood, anxiety, substance use, eating, and disruptive behaviour disorders, as well as suicidal ideation and suicide attempts. We calculated the percentage of respondents whose mental disorder came after the first abortion. The role of violence was also explored. Population attributable fractions were calculated for significant associations between abortion and mental disorders. RESULTS: After adjusting for sociodemographics, abortion was associated with an increased likelihood of several mental disorders--mood disorders (adjusted odds ratio [AOR] ranging from 1.75 to 1.91), anxiety disorders (AOR ranging from 1.87 to 1.91), substance use disorders (AOR ranging from 3.14 to 4.99), as well as suicidal ideation and suicide attempts (AOR ranging from 1.97 to 2.18). Adjusting for violence weakened some of these associations. For all disorders examined, less than one-half of women reported that their mental disorder had begun after the first abortion. Population attributable fractions ranged from 5.8% (suicidal ideation) to 24.7% (drug abuse). CONCLUSIONS: Our study confirms a strong association between abortion and mental disorders. Possible mechanisms of this relation are discussed.
